Heim > Web-Frontend > js-Tutorial > Hauptteil

Erstellen barrierefreier Reaktionsanwendungen

WBOY
Freigeben: 2024-08-26 21:43:36
Original
410 Leute haben es durchsucht

Building Accessible React Applications

In der heutigen digitalen Landschaft ist Barrierefreiheit nicht nur ein Schlagwort, sondern eine Notwendigkeit. Durch die Erstellung barrierefreier Webanwendungen wird sichergestellt, dass alle Benutzer, auch solche mit Behinderungen, effektiv mit Ihren Inhalten interagieren können. React, eine der beliebtesten JavaScript-Bibliotheken zum Erstellen von Benutzeroberflächen, bietet mehrere Tools und Best Practices, die Entwicklern bei der Erstellung barrierefreier Anwendungen helfen. In diesem Artikel werden wichtige Strategien und Techniken zum Erstellen barrierefreier React-Anwendungen untersucht.

1. Web-Barrierefreiheit verstehen

Webbarrierefreiheit bedeutet das Entwerfen und Entwickeln von Websites und Anwendungen, die von Menschen mit verschiedenen Behinderungen, einschließlich Seh-, Hör-, motorischen und kognitiven Beeinträchtigungen, genutzt werden können. Die Web Content Accessibility Guidelines (WCAG) bieten eine Reihe von Standards, die Entwickler befolgen sollten, um sicherzustellen, dass ihre Inhalte für alle Benutzer zugänglich sind.

2. Verwenden Sie semantisches HTML

Die Grundlage jeder barrierefreien Webanwendung ist semantisches HTML. Elemente wie

,
Quelle:dev.to
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age
Über uns Haftungsausschluss Sitemap
Chinesische PHP-Website:Online-PHP-Schulung für das Gemeinwohl,Helfen Sie PHP-Lernenden, sich schnell weiterzuentwickeln!